Top Chinese climate envoy stresses south-south cooperation at COP23

China's special representative on climate change affairs Xie Zhenhua delivers a speech during the high-level forum on south-south cooperation on climate change held in the China pavilion at the 23rd Conference of Parties to the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change in Bonn, Germany, on Nov. 15, 2017. Xie Zhenhua stressed the importance of the south-south climate cooperation, and expressed hope that the ongoing UN climate talks would generate substantial results addressing issues that concern developing countries and an unequivocal arrangement for implementing the Paris Agreement.
